[1] Stream aquifer hydrology and nitrate removal were studied, over a period of 2 years, in an unsaturated riparian zone, bounded by an intermittent Mediterranean stream, (Fuirosos, northeastern Spain). The riparian groundwater system is characterized by drastic hydrological changes and by mixing of stream water with hillslope groundwater. The hillslope groundwater flowed through a medium with ...

The biological degradation of perchlorate was examined using a laboratory-scale, autotrophic, packed-bed biofilm reactor. The reactor was operated in unsaturated-flow mode and continuously fed water containing perchlorate (ClO4-) (as an electron acceptor), and a gas mixture of hydrogen (5%) and carbon dioxide at a retention time of 1.5 min.
